SAO KNIFE and AMMO Launch Limited "Military Rank" Collaborative Folder Series
Chinese custom knife brand SAO KNIFE has officially unveiled its latest collaboration with independent EDC designer AMMO—a limited-edition folding knife collection dubbed "Military Rank."
